  5. 27 de sept. de 2016 · 1. Purse Snatching: Yank your purse from shoulder/lap and run away. Targets: Loose bags, shoulder bags, people not holding their purse. Avoid by: Wearing a crossbody which is harder to pull off, keep a hand on the bag at all times. Wear your bag in front of you.

Snatch theft is a criminal act, common in Southeast Asia, South America, and Southern Europe, [citation needed] of forcefully stealing a pedestrian's personal property by employing rob-and-run tactics.
